Description

A beautiful early 20th Century (c.1940) scene in Impressionist oil, showing a fine country house bathed in incredibly orange, late afternoon sunlight on an Autumn afternoon. The artist has monogrammed to the lower right and the painting has been presented in a gilt finished wood frame with off-white slip. On board.

Condition

The condition is typical for a picture of this age including some discolouration.

Size

23.5 x 34cm (9.3" x 13.4")
Framed Size: 37.5 x 48cm (14.8" x 18.9")

Artist Biography

Painter who was educated at Cambridge University, then studied at Westminster School of Art, 1926–9, with Walter Bayes. Showed at RBA, RCamA, Paris Salon and Lincolnshire Artists’ Society, sometimes just signing work J B. Lincoln’s Usher Gallery holds his works: A Break in the Clouds, November Sky and Humberstone Foreshore, all presented by Sir Hickman Bacon in the 1930s. Lived at Grimsby, Lincolnshire
